Blockchain data and analytics firm Chainalysis opens regional headquarters in Dubai
Blockchain data and analysis company Chainalysis announced the opening of its Southern Europe, Middle East, Central Asia, and Africa headquarters in Dubai. According to the announcement, the analysis company has been "actively engaging" with local government stakeholders to provide advice on promoting innovative cryptocurrency industry regulatory development practices. The regional headquarters will enable the company to support emerging markets such as India, Africa, and Central Asia. Nicola Buonanno, Vice President of Chainalysis for Europe, the Middle East, and Southern Africa, said that the UAE market is at a "critical point" and that institutional-scale transfers currently account for the "vast majority" of the country's cryptocurrency activity.
